name: Android CI

on:
  push:
    branches:
      - '**'
  pull_request:
    branches:
      - '**'

jobs:
  build:

    runs-on: macos-latest

    steps:
    - uses: actions/checkout@v2
    - name: set up JDK 1.8
      uses: actions/setup-java@v1
      with:
        java-version: 1.8
    - name: Build with Gradle
      run: ./gradlew clean build
    - name: Android Emulator Runner
      uses: ReactiveCircus/android-emulator-runner@v2.5.0
      with:
        api-level: 29
        script: ./gradlew connectedCheck